In this video, we received a Western Digital My Passport hard drive from San Carlos II, Texas, with a broken PCB (Printed Circuit Board). The PCB is crucial because it’s where you connect the power and data cables to access your files.
Many users assume that simply swapping out the PCB will restore their data, but that’s not the case with these Western Digital models. Each board contains two essential chips that are specific to your drive:
MCU (Microcontroller Unit) – This chip holds the encryption keys necessary for accessing your files.
ROM chip – This chip contains vital firmware that governs your drive’s operation.
To recover the data, we meticulously desolder these chips from the faulty PCB and transfer them onto a compatible new board. After transferring, we connect power, ground, and four data lines directly to the drive to safely read the data.
This process highlights why professional data recovery services are often the only viable option when a My Passport drive fails. Without the right tools and expertise, your precious files would remain inaccessible.

Hard drives can fail for several reasons, but the four most common types of failures include:
1. Bad sectors – Over time, parts of the drive can wear out, causing freezing, delays, or complete inaccessibility of your files.
2. Firmware issues – Corrupted code on the drive can render it unusable, making your data seem lost.
3. Damaged PCB (circuit board) – If the board that powers the drive fails, it may not turn on at all.
4. Crashed heads – This severe failure is often indicated by clicking sounds and requires careful head assembly replacement for data extraction.

One of the most prevalent issues we encounter is read/write head failure. When these tiny components malfunction, they can produce clicking noises and prevent data access. Our team uses specialized equipment to replace the heads and recover your data safely.

How We Recover Data from Flash Media
SD Card Recovery – SD cards can fail due to various reasons such as controller malfunctions, corrupted firmware, or physical damage. To tackle these issues, we bypass the faulty controller and connect directly to the memory chip using precision soldering methods. This allows us to extract the raw data directly from the source.
USB Flash Drive Recovery – For USB flash drives, we carefully desolder the NAND memory chips and employ specialized readers to retrieve the raw data stored within.
Rebuilding Your Files
Obtaining the raw data is just the beginning of the recovery process. Flash memory employs complex algorithms that scatter and mix information to enhance speed and durability. When we extract this data, it appears as a chaotic jumble rather than recognizable files.
Using advanced tools and software, we meticulously reconstruct the data into a usable format. This process includes correcting errors, reassembling fragmented files, and restoring the original folder structure — ensuring that your cherished photos, videos, and documents are accessible once more.

In the realm of data storage, SSDs (Solid-State Drives) and NVMe (Non-Volatile Memory Express) drives represent cutting-edge technology, utilizing NAND flash memory chips instead of traditional spinning disks. This innovative design not only enhances speed and performance but also introduces specific vulnerabilities that can lead to unexpected data loss.
Common reasons for failure in SSDs and NVMe drives include deteriorating NAND chips, firmware corruption, or issues with the drive’s circuit board. Should the problem lie with the PCB (Printed Circuit Board), our expert team is equipped to perform meticulous repairs to restore functionality.
A frequent challenge we encounter is a malfunctioning translator, which is crucial for locating stored files. When this component fails, the drive may seem empty or inaccessible. Our advanced recovery techniques involve uploading specialized code into the drive's memory to reconstruct the translator, allowing us to retrieve your valuable data.
In more complex situations, recovery may necessitate highly specialized procedures, such as transferring multiple NAND chips to a functional board. This intricate process requires precision and expertise but can be the key to success when conventional recovery methods fall short.

Cell Phone CPU Repair & Data Recovery

Cell Phone CPU Repair & Data Recovery
When addressing cell phone data recovery, the CPU is essential. For iPhones and Android devices running version 7.0 or newer, a functioning CPU is necessary to retrieve any data. Unlike older models, accessing the storage chip alone is not sufficient due to encryption. The CPU must interact with the logic EEPROM, a security chip on the motherboard, to obtain unique encryption keys required for file access. Without this interaction, data recovery is impossible. If the CPU is damaged—due to a hard fall or improper removal techniques—the connection pads beneath it can become detached, preventing the phone from powering on. To recover your information, both the CPU and EEPROM must work together. At MDRepairs, we specialize in remote, mail-in CPU repair for cell phone data recovery. Our technicians can meticulously rebuild the tiny traces on the CPU to restore communication with the EEPROM, allowing the device to boot again. Depending on damage severity, repairs may take several hours; for instance, one recent job required about 10 hours of work. Hard Drive Platter Damage Data Recovery Explained
If your hard drive has suffered platter damage, data recovery can become a complex process. Hard drive platters are the disks inside your drive where data is magnetically stored. Damage can occur due to physical impacts, overheating, or contamination from dust when the drive is opened outside of a cleanroom environment. At MDRepairs, we focus on hard drive platter damage data recovery through our secure mail-in service, providing an effective solution for customers in San Carlos II, Texas.
When the read/write heads come into contact with the platters, they can create scratches and other forms of physical damage. This can complicate recovery efforts, but it does not necessarily mean that your data is irretrievable. In many instances, it is possible to recover data from undamaged sections of the platters.
The recovery process begins with a comprehensive evaluation of the hard drive to assess the extent of the platter damage and any potential contamination. Our technicians then proceed to clean the platters meticulously and replace any damaged read/write heads. The goal is to extract as much data as possible from the intact areas of the platters.

Regular Data Recovery Software vs. Professional Tools

Many users turn to regular data recovery software when faced with hard drive issues, believing it will solve their problems. However, this type of software often lacks the capability to address severe data loss situations effectively. In many instances, these programs can exacerbate the issue by getting stuck on bad sectors. When a drive repeatedly attempts to read damaged areas, it places undue stress on the platters, which can lead to irreversible damage and lower the likelihood of successful recovery.

In contrast, professionals utilize specialized hardware tools designed specifically for safe data recovery. At MDRepairs, advanced equipment from Ace Lab and DeepSpar is employed to connect externally to your hard drive. This method allows for stabilization, bypassing of bad sectors, and efficient data extraction without risking further harm. Once the majority of your files are secured, technicians can revisit the problematic areas to attempt additional recovery safely.

This hardware-based approach is a trusted practice among leading recovery labs globally, ensuring that clients receive the best possible chance of retrieving their data. Newer MacBooks are designed differently than older models, and this makes MacBook data recovery far more complex. Instead of using a removable solid-state drive (SSD), Apple now integrates storage directly onto the motherboard. That means if your MacBook’s motherboard fails, the only way to retrieve your data is by repairing the original board. Unlike older models where we could simply transfer the SSD to another machine, recovery now requires advanced board-level work.
